🧩 Understanding WH-Questions



The top-left worksheet explains the meaning of each WH-word with examples and images:

| WH-Word | Meaning | Example Image |
|--------|--------|---------------|
| Who | A person | Doctor wearing a stethoscope |
| What | A thing or action | Bananas (thing), child running (action) |
| When | A time | Clock showing time, sunset |
| Where | A place | Red barn |
| Why | Reason something happened | Person petting a dog (perhaps showing affection) |
| How | Method or way | Partially visible – likely shows a process |

This helps learners associate words with meanings visually.

💡 How to Use This Resource



1. Review the WH-Question Poster: Help students understand what each WH-word asks.
2. Look at Photos: Use real images to make abstract concepts concrete.
3. Answer Questions: Practice oral or written responses.
4. Discuss Context: Ask follow-up questions like “Why does a firefighter save people?” to deepen understanding.
